The Cotton Spandex Sateen - White Tiger fabric features a standard complexity printed design with floral and foliage motifs in deep blue, fern green, and light orange tones. This design is characterized by its artistic flower, pictorial floral, and stylized floral details that provide a visual sense of harmony and creativity. This fabric, printed on one side using digital textile printing, has a soft texture to the touch. Its weight of 195 gr/m2 and width of 150 cm make it perfect for fashion and home projects. It would pair perfectly with solid colors in white, black, and dark gray tones.
The Cotton Spandex Sateen - White Tiger fabric is a strong and durable fabric that adapts to a wide variety of projects. Its soft texture and weight make it ideal for making garments such as dresses, shirts, jumpsuits, pants, shorts, and fashion accessories. This fabric is also ideal for manufacturing home textile products such as pillowcases and napkins.
This fabric should be cared for following the manufacturers instructions, which include washing at a maximum temperature of 30ºC, do not bleach, iron at a cool temperature, dry clean except for trichloroethylene, and tumble dry at a reduced temperature.
The printing technology used to manufacture this fabric is REACTIVE DIRECT DIGITAL (NATURAL FIBERS). This digital textile printing process uses reactive inks that adhere to the fabric fibers, which guarantees high quality and durability of the printed colors. In addition, this technology offers high resolution and precise and sharp details in the print.
